When shipping from Altamira, Mexico to San Juan, Puerto Rico, anticipate significant disruptions during the Atlantic Hurricane Season (June-November) and North Atlantic Winter Storms (November-March). Include extra buffer days for transit and delivery commitments, especially during peak storm months (August-October and December-March). Arrange vessel space and inland transport well in advance of the Christmas retail peak (October-December) and the North America summer holiday peak (late June-early September) to avoid capacity shortages. Monitor potential delays due to Saharan dust activity (June-September) and ensure flexible routing options are in place.

For moisture-sensitive automotive parts, select inner sealed pouches around each component, then place them in Sturdy cartons with sufficient cushioning. Seal all seams with Water-resistant tape and clearly mark cartons “Keep Dry”. For export or long-duration transit, Consider adding Desiccant packs inside master cartons and, if needed, inside the shipping container.
You may ship vehicle tires with boxed car parts, but They should be physically separated and properly secured. We recommend palletizing boxed Vehicle components and then stacking or racking Tires so they do not press against or rub cartons. Avoid placing heavy loose Tires on top of fragile or moisture-sensitive vehicle parts, as this can cause crushing or punctures during transit.
Fluid-filled automotive parts such as fuel system components, shock absorbers, or oil coolers often require special handling notes, depending on the type and quantity of fluid. You should Check whether the product is classified as dangerous goods under DOT and IATA regulations and Provide the appropriate safety data sheets (SDS), UN numbers, and packing group information if applicable. Even when not regulated as hazardous, clearly Indicate “Contains Fluids – Keep Upright” on packaging and shipping documents to guide carriers.
High-value auto components such as engines, transmissions, ECUs, and safety modules should be shipped with enhanced transit insurance. Carrier default liability Is often limited and may not cover the full replacement cost of specialized Automotive parts. We recommend insuring based on replacement value, documenting serial numbers and condition at pickup, and retaining invoices and packing lists so any claim for loss, impact damage, or moisture-related failure Can be processed efficiently.
To reduce damage in mixed auto parts pallet loads, position the heaviest metal components at the bottom, with lighter boxes and vehicle tires above. Use Corner boards, Stretch wrap plus strapping to stabilize the load and prevent shifting. Keep moisture-sensitive Car parts toward the center of the pallet, away from potential leaks or condensation on trailer walls, and Clearly label any fragile or orientation-sensitive cartons so handlers Can follow correct handling procedures.
The necessary documentation typically includes a commercial invoice, packing list, and any specific export/import permits required for automotive parts. Additionally, a Bill of Lading and customs declarations must be completed to comply with regulations between Mexico and Puerto Rico.
Yes, seasonal considerations include the hurricane season, which typically runs from June to November, potentially impacting shipping routes and schedules. It is advisable to monitor weather conditions during this period when planning shipments.
